How to Choose a Kitchen Scales for Baking and Portion Control

  • Accuracy and Increments: Look for 1-gram increments or 0.1-ounce precision. For serious baking, 1g accuracy is the sweet spot for scaling flour, sugar, and sourdough starters without the fluctuation of cheaper sensors.
  • Capacity vs. Footprint: 11 pounds covers 95% of baking and meal prep, but choose 22lb or 33lb if you weigh large batches, bulk ingredients, or packages. Larger capacity usually means a bigger platform, so balance power with counter space.
  • Tare and Unit Conversions: A responsive tare button is non-negotiable for zeroing out bowls and adding ingredients sequentially. Ensure it supports grams, ounces, pounds:ounces, milliliters, and fluid ounces for both dry and liquid measuring.
  • Power and Cleanup: USB rechargeable models save on batteries and are ideal for daily use, while battery models are great for occasional bakers. Prioritize stainless steel platforms and waterproof or spill-resistant designs for easy wiping after sticky doughs.
  • Display and Usability: A bright, backlit LCD angled for easy reading, non-slip feet, and intuitive controls prevent errors. Auto-off and low-battery indicators add convenience for fast-paced portioning and meal prep routines.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I really need a kitchen scale for baking?

Yes, especially for baking. Volume measurements with cups can vary by 20% or more depending on how you pack flour, leading to dry or dense results. A scale measures by weight in grams for consistent, repeatable outcomes and is essential for bread, pastry, and recipes using baker’s percentages.

What is the tare function and why is it important?

Tare resets the display to zero after placing a bowl or container on the scale. This lets you add multiple ingredients to the same bowl sequentially and weigh only the new ingredient added, which saves dishes, speeds up prep, and is critical for both baking and tracking exact portions for diets.

How accurate does a kitchen scale need to be for portion control?

For portion control and general cooking, 1-gram or 0.1-ounce accuracy is more than sufficient. This level tracks calories and macros reliably for weight loss, keto, or meal prep. Ultra-precise 0.1g scales are only needed for espresso or specialty pastry work.

Are rechargeable or battery-powered scales better?

Rechargeable USB and Type-C scales are more cost-effective and eco-friendly for daily use and often include waterproofing. Battery-powered scales are perfectly reliable for occasional use and can sit ready for months without charging. Choose based on how often you cook and whether you prefer plug-and-charge convenience.
